本發明是有關於一種監控系統,特別是有關於調整具異常情形的顯示畫面尺寸的畫面調整監控系統。 The present invention relates to a monitoring system, and more particularly to a screen adjustment monitoring system for adjusting the size of a display screen with an abnormal situation.
現今的監控設備,常見是於多處設置攝影機進行拍攝,並將每一攝影機的拍攝畫面,以一顯示器呈現一拍攝畫面,或是以一顯示器呈現多個拍攝畫面方式進行呈現。 In today's monitoring equipment, it is common to set up cameras in multiple places for shooting, and to present a shooting picture of each camera as a shooting picture on one display, or to present multiple shooting pictures in one display.
但是,此種方式僅是同時呈現所有拍攝畫面,並無法一眼就看出那個拍攝畫面是具有異常情形。 However, this method only presents all the captured images at the same time, and it cannot be seen at a glance that the captured image has an abnormal situation.
為解決上述問題,本發明係揭露一種畫面調整監控系統,針對異常畫面進行調整顯示尺寸。 In order to solve the above problems, the present invention discloses a picture adjustment monitoring system for adjusting an display size for an abnormal picture.
本發明揭露的畫面調整監控系統,包括一顯示單元、複數個攝影單元與一處理單元。每一攝影單元係拍攝以產生一畫面資料。處理單元則利用顯示單元將各畫面資料於以複數個畫面顯示,並分析各畫面資料中的一特定畫面具異常情形時,放大特定畫面的顯示比例。 The picture adjustment monitoring system disclosed in the present invention comprises a display unit, a plurality of shooting units and a processing unit. Each camera unit is photographed to produce a picture material. The processing unit enlarges the display ratio of the specific screen when the display unit displays the respective screen data on a plurality of screens and analyzes a specific screen in each screen material with an abnormality.
本發明所揭畫面調整監控系統,其特點在於,當處理單元判斷有任一畫面具有異常情形時,即放大畫面的顯示比例或尺度,故管理者可一眼就看出那個拍攝畫面是具有異常情形。 The picture adjustment monitoring system disclosed in the present invention is characterized in that when the processing unit determines that any picture has an abnormal situation, that is, enlarges the display scale or scale of the picture, the manager can see at a glance that the shooting picture has an abnormal situation. .

茲配合圖式將本發明實施例詳細說明如下。 The embodiments of the present invention are described in detail below with reference to the drawings.
請參閱圖1繪示本發明實施例之畫面調整監控系統的第一種系統架構圖,圖2A與2B繪示本發明實施例之畫面調整監控系統的畫面調節示意圖。此系統包括一顯示單元110、複數個攝影單元120與一處理單元130。處理單元130連接顯示單元110與攝影單元120。 FIG. 1 is a first system architecture diagram of a screen adjustment monitoring system according to an embodiment of the present invention. FIG. 2A and FIG. 2B are schematic diagrams of screen adjustment of a screen adjustment monitoring system according to an embodiment of the present invention. The system includes a display unit 110, a plurality of photographing units 120, and a processing unit 130. The processing unit 130 connects the display unit 110 and the photographing unit 120.
顯示單元110為具呈現畫面的功能的顯示器或是螢幕。攝影單元120用以拍攝所在環境,以產生畫面資料111。每一攝影單元120產生的畫面資料111皆會回傳至處理單元130。處理單元130可為個人電腦、伺服器等具資料、程式的運算與處理能力的運算設備。 The display unit 110 is a display or a screen having a function of presenting a picture. The photographing unit 120 is used to photograph the environment to generate the screen material 111. The picture material 111 generated by each of the photographing units 120 is returned to the processing unit 130. The processing unit 130 can be a computing device with computing and processing capabilities of data and programs, such as a personal computer or a server.
處理單元130會利用顯示單元110將各畫面資料111於以複數個畫面顯示,並分析各畫面資料111中的一特定畫面112具異常情形時,放大特定畫面112的顯示比例。其中,處理單元130在利用顯示單元110顯示時,於一般狀態下,會將各畫面資料111以預定設置或人工調整的顯示比例、尺寸進行顯示。例如,預設狀態皆為同一顯示比例或解析度。 The processing unit 130 displays the display ratio of the specific screen 112 by displaying the screen data 111 on a plurality of screens by using the display unit 110 and analyzing an abnormality of a specific screen 112 in each of the screen materials 111. When the processing unit 130 displays by the display unit 110, in the normal state, each screen material 111 is displayed in a predetermined setting or manually adjusted display scale and size. For example, the preset states are all the same display scale or resolution.
其中,處理單元130調節各畫面資料111的顯示尺寸時,調整方式至少包括下列數種: Wherein, when the processing unit 130 adjusts the display size of each screen material 111, the adjustment manner includes at least the following types:
(1)處理單元130放大特定畫面112的顯示比例時,縮小特定畫面112之外的各畫面資料111的顯示比例。 (1) When the processing unit 130 enlarges the display ratio of the specific screen 112, the display ratio of each of the screen materials 111 other than the specific screen 112 is reduced.
(2)處理單元130調整特定畫面112與特定畫面112之外的各畫面資料111顯示排列與排列順序。 (2) The processing unit 130 adjusts the display arrangement and arrangement order of the respective picture materials 111 other than the specific picture 112 and the specific picture 112.
此外,處理單元130判斷畫面資料111是否存在異常情形的方式,至少包括下列數種: In addition, the manner in which the processing unit 130 determines whether the screen material 111 has an abnormal situation includes at least the following:
(1)處理單元130係擷取每一畫面資料111的連續時段的二畫面,並依據此二畫面之比對是否存在差異,藉以判斷是否存在上述異常情形。 (1) The processing unit 130 extracts two pictures of consecutive time periods of each picture material 111, and determines whether there is such an abnormal situation according to whether there is a difference according to the ratio of the two pictures.
(2)如圖3繪示本發明實施例之畫面調整監控系統的第二種系統架構圖。此系統更包括一偵測單元140,藉由偵測單元140偵測攝影 單元120所在環境,處理單元130會依據偵測結果以判斷是否存在上述異常情形。其中,偵測單元140可為溫度偵測單元、紅外線偵測單元、設置於此環境地上的壓力偵測單元與光偵測單元之至少其一。 (2) FIG. 3 is a second system architecture diagram of a picture adjustment monitoring system according to an embodiment of the present invention. The system further includes a detecting unit 140, and detecting the camera by the detecting unit 140 In the environment where the unit 120 is located, the processing unit 130 determines whether the abnormal situation exists according to the detection result. The detecting unit 140 can be at least one of a temperature detecting unit, an infrared detecting unit, a pressure detecting unit and a light detecting unit disposed on the environment.
在一些實施例中,處理單元130會分析異常情形於環境的所在位置,以調整攝影單元120的拍攝方向,調整方式至少包括如下: In some embodiments, the processing unit 130 analyzes the location of the abnormal situation in the environment to adjust the shooting direction of the photographing unit 120, and the adjustment manner includes at least the following:
(1)處理單元130依據異常情形於特定畫面112的畫面位置,產生一視角參數,再依據視角參數調整特定畫面112所屬之攝影單元120的拍攝方向,使攝影單元120朝向異常情形的位置進行拍攝。 (1) The processing unit 130 generates a viewing angle parameter according to the abnormal situation in the screen position of the specific screen 112, and then adjusts the shooting direction of the photographing unit 120 to which the specific screen 112 belongs according to the viewing angle parameter, so that the photographing unit 120 shoots toward the position of the abnormal situation. .
(2)每一拍攝單元之所屬環境皆配置有一偵測單元140,偵測單元140連接處理單元130,並用以偵測異常情形於環境的所在位置以產生一偵測參數。處理單元130依據偵測參數分析異常情形於特定畫面112的畫面位置,以產生一視角參數,以依據視角參數令特定畫面112所屬之攝影單元120的拍攝方向。 (2) A detection unit 140 is disposed in the environment of each camera unit. The detecting unit 140 is connected to the processing unit 130 and is configured to detect an abnormal situation at the location of the environment to generate a detection parameter. The processing unit 130 analyzes the abnormality of the screen position of the specific screen 112 according to the detection parameter to generate a viewing angle parameter to make the shooting direction of the photographing unit 120 to which the specific screen 112 belongs according to the viewing angle parameter.
其中,偵測單元140可為(a)紅外線偵測單元,係依據發射的紅外光及對應的反射光以產生距離偵測參數,供處理單元130依據距離偵測參數分析異常情形於特定畫面112的畫面位置。 The detecting unit 140 may be (a) an infrared detecting unit that generates a distance detecting parameter according to the emitted infrared light and the corresponding reflected light, and the processing unit 130 analyzes the abnormal condition according to the distance detecting parameter to the specific screen 112. The position of the screen.
(b)偵測單元140可為溫度偵測單元,係依據環境溫度變化以產生溫度偵測參數,處理單元130依據溫度偵測參數分析異常情形於特定畫面112的畫面位置。 (b) The detecting unit 140 may be a temperature detecting unit that generates a temperature detecting parameter according to the ambient temperature change, and the processing unit 130 analyzes the abnormal situation on the screen position of the specific screen 112 according to the temperature detecting parameter.
(c)偵測單元140可為壓力偵測單元,設置於環境的地面,係依據壓力變化以產生壓力偵測參數,處理單元130依據壓力偵測參數分析異常情形於特定畫面112的畫面位置。 (c) The detecting unit 140 may be a pressure detecting unit disposed on the ground of the environment, and the pressure detecting parameter is generated according to the pressure change. The processing unit 130 analyzes the abnormal situation on the screen position of the specific screen 112 according to the pressure detecting parameter.
(d)偵測單元140為光偵測單元,係依據環境的遮光變化以產生光偵測參數,處理單元130依據光偵測參數分析異常情形於特定畫面112的畫面位置。 (d) The detecting unit 140 is a light detecting unit that generates light detecting parameters according to the shading change of the environment, and the processing unit 130 analyzes the abnormal position of the screen position of the specific screen 112 according to the light detecting parameters.
